1. What Duewell is
Duewell is a tool that helps freelancers and small businesses follow up on their own unpaid invoices. Based on information you provide, Duewell generates draft follow-up messages and a formal demand letter, escalating in tone across stages, written for you to review and send yourself.
Duewell drafts. You send. Duewell does not send any message to your clients or contact your clients on your behalf. Every message is generated for you to review, edit, and send from your own email or channels, at your own discretion. Any notification Duewell sends by email goes only to you, the account holder — never to your clients.
